XML 73 R39.htm IDEA: XBRL DOCUMENT v3.24.1
Property and Equipment, Net (Schedule of Property and Equipment, Net) (Details) - USD ($)
$ in Thousands
Dec. 31, 2023
Dec. 31, 2022
Property, Plant and Equipment [Line Items]    
Cost $ 529 $ 532
Less - accumulated depreciation (226) (165)
Property Plant And Equipment Net 303 367
Computers [Member]    
Property, Plant and Equipment [Line Items]    
Cost 68 70
Furniture and equipment [Member]    
Property, Plant and Equipment [Line Items]    
Cost 33 33
Laboratory equipment [Member]    
Property, Plant and Equipment [Line Items]    
Cost 400 399
Website development [Member]    
Property, Plant and Equipment [Line Items]    
Cost 14 14
Leasehold improvements [Member]    
Property, Plant and Equipment [Line Items]    
Cost $ 14 $ 16